    2. I am allergic to antihistamines (they will kill me) so I cannot take most otc remedies. Also, I don't recommend you take a cough medicine with codeine or another opiate added, as that will suppress your respiration, as any painkiller will. A lot of other cough remedies can aggravate inflammation. So I use, on my Doctor's advice, Mucinex, extra strength 12-hour, twice daily. Keeps my lungs completely free of trapped mucus. Loosens it and it comes right up, so none builds up. Also prevents a runny nose. At least for me it does. Really good stuff.
